Output 71e010209239d034f1823bea3251a730f5d32a826d5376b1d52dc3d2e109db06:1

value
654365000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caa3ff3def359085faf4179cddbe34e232b642b OP_EQUAL
address
MR6jDfAYio9HahPBRHdQPYzzjHgLjDgaCi
transaction
71e010209239d034f1823bea3251a730f5d32a826d5376b1d52dc3d2e109db06
spent
true